Which term is defined as the force applied to the object divided by the mass of the object?

speed
velocity
mass
acceleration

Answers

Answer:

acceleration

Explanation:

From the question: "FORCE... divided by the MASS..." is translated to a math equation as "F / m", where "F" is the force and "m" is the mass.  

Now, the second Newton's law says "F = m . a ", where a is acceleration.

If you move m to the left side, clearly you have "F / m", and "a" is alone to the right. Math equation:

a = F / m

acceleration = force / mass

Traveling in circle requires a net force

Answers

Answer:

Circular motion requires a net inward or "centripetal" force. Without a net centripetal force, an object cannot travel in circular motion. In fact, if the forces are balanced, then an object in motion continues in motion in a straight line at constant speed.
